Australian procurement policies increasingly favour suppliers with ISO 14001 environmental management certification. Hot-dip galvanizing β with its long service life and full recyclability β aligns perfectly with Australia's net-zero 2050 commitments and circular economy principles.
Next-generation duplex coating systems (galvanizing + powder coat) and zinc-aluminium alloy galvanizing are gaining traction in harsh coastal and industrial environments, offering 2β3x the service life of standard galvanized fittings.
